#663e42 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#663e42 is composed of 40% red, 24.3%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 354 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#663e42 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c7c84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#663e42 color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#663e42 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#663e42 has RGB values of R:102, G:62,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.35,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6700610.

Shades and Tints of #663e42

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040303 is the darkest color, while #faf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#663e42

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535151 is the less saturated color, while #9f0515 is the most saturated one.
